4,4-Diarylpiperidine compounds, preferably 4,4-diphenylpiperidine which are substituted or unsubstituted in the 1-position of the piperidine nucleus, such as 1-(lower alkyl)-4,4-diphenylpiperidines, 1-(lower alkyl)-4-phenyl-4-tolylpiperidines, and their substantially non-toxic, pharmaceutically-acceptable acid addition salts, are highly effective central nervous system (CNS) stimulants which are superior to known amphetamine-type stimulants. A novel and highly advantageous process of making such 4,4-diarylpiperidine compounds comprises reacting a 4-aryl-4-hydroxypiperidine compound which may be substituted in its 3-position by an aroyl group, with an aromatic hydrocarbon, in particular with benzene, in the presence of a Friedel-Crafts-type catalyst.
